SAD chief condemns Central agencies for role in SGPC poll
Sukhbir Singh Badal slams AAP government for lawlessness, highlights failures of Punjab Chief Minister Bhagwant Mann
Shiromani Akali Dal (SAD) president Sukhbir Singh Badal on Monday hailed the re-election of Advocate Harjinder Singh Dhami as President of the Shiromani Gurdwara Parbandhak Committee (SGPC) for a fifth consecutive term, calling it a victory of the Khalsa Panth over central forces.
While campaigning for party candidate principal Sukhwinder Kaur Randhawa in the region, Badal criticised attempts by leaders aligned with central agencies to take control of the SGPC through their supporters. “I congratulate the SGPC members who united to defeat this conspiracy and ensured a historic victory for Advocate Dhami in the elections to the super parliament of the Khalsa Panth,” he said.
Earlier, addressing a large public meeting at Chahal village, Sukhbir Badal lashed out at the Aam Aadmi Party (AAP) government, accusing it of plunging the state into lawlessness. He pointed to the rising number of targeted killings, including the recent murder of a Kabaddi player in Jagraon and the killing of a youth by gangsters in Batala. “Targeted killings are happening every day. Despite this, Chief Minister Bhagwant Mann has failed to take effective action to curb the growing influence of gangsters in the state,” he stated.
Badal challenged the CM to explain what he had done for the people of Punjab during his tenure. “Whenever I ask Bhagwant Mann this question, he gets frustrated,” said Badal. “I challenge him again to tell the people what he has done for farmers, labourers, youth, women or traders. Every section of society has been betrayed by the AAP.”
The SAD president also condemned Punjab Pradesh Congress president for allegedly insulting the hard-working Mazhabi community.
During the course of the day, Sukhbir Singh Badal addressed gatherings in several villages, including Kalas, Sohal, Chabal Kham, and Jhabal Pukhta. He welcomed Ramneek Singh Khera and his followers into the SAD fold.
Badal was accompanied by several senior party leaders, including Sikander Singh Maluka, NK Sharma, Lakhbir Singh Lodhinangal, Dr Daljit Cheema, Satnam Singh Rahi, Nath Hamidi, Surjit Singh Garhi, Bhupinder Singh Bhinda and Ranjit Singh Dhillon.
